# exceptions
# https://www.python.org/dev/peps/pep-0249/#exceptions
class Warning(Exception): ...
class Error(Exception): ...
class InterfaceError(Error): ...
class DatabaseError(Error): ...
class DataError(DatabaseError): ...
class OperationalError(DatabaseError): ...
class IntegrityError(DatabaseError): ...
class InternalError(DatabaseError): ...
class ProgrammingError(DatabaseError): ...
class NotSupportedError(DatabaseError): ...
# an ODBC connection to the database, for managing database transactions and creating cursors
# https://www.python.org/dev/peps/pep-0249/#connection-objects
class Connection:
# read-write attributes
autocommit: bool
maxwrite: int
timeout: int
# read-only attributes
searchescape: str
# implemented dunder methods
def __enter__(self) -> Connection: ...
def __exit__(self, exc_type, exc_value, traceback) -> None: ...
# define text encoding for data, metadata, etc.
def setencoding(self, encoding: str, ctype: Optional[int]) -> None: ...
def setdecoding(self, encoding: str, ctype: Optional[int]) -> None: ...
# connection attributes
def getinfo(self, infotype: int, /) -> Any: ...
def set_attr(self, attr_id: int, value: int, /) -> None: ...
# handle non-standard database data types
def add_output_converter(self, sqltype: int, new_converter: Callable, /) -> None: ...
def get_output_converter(self, sqltype: int, /) -> Optional[Callable]: ...
def remove_output_converter(self, sqltype: int, /) -> None: ...
def clear_output_converters(self) -> None: ...
# query functions (in rough order of use)
def cursor(self) -> Cursor: ...
def execute(self, sql: str, *params) -> Cursor: ...
def commit(self) -> None: ...
def rollback(self) -> None: ...
def close(self) -> None: ...
# cursors are vehicles for executing SQL statements and returning their results
# https://www.python.org/dev/peps/pep-0249/#cursor-objects
class Cursor:
# read-write attributes
arraysize: int
fast_executemany: bool
noscan: bool
# read-only attributes
description: Tuple[Tuple[str, Any, int, int, int, int, bool]]
messages: Optional[List[Tuple[str, Union[str, bytes]]]]
rowcount: int
connection: Connection
# implemented dunder methods
def __enter__(self) -> Cursor: ...
def __exit__(self, exc_type, exc_value, traceback) -> None: ...
def __iter__(self, /) -> Cursor: ...
def __next__(self, /) -> Row: ...
# query functions (in rough order of use)
def setinputsizes(self, sizes: List[Tuple[int, int, int]], /) -> None: ...
def setoutputsize(self) -> None: ...
def execute(self, sql: str, *params) -> Cursor: ...
def executemany(self, sql: str, params: Union[Sequence, Iterator, Generator], /) -> None: ...
def fetchone(self) -> Row: ...
def fetchmany(self, size: int, /) -> List[Row]: ...
def fetchall(self) -> List[Row]: ...
def fetchval(self) -> Any: ...
def skip(self, count: int, /) -> None: ...
def nextset(self) -> bool: ...
def commit(self) -> None: ...
def rollback(self) -> None: ...
def cancel(self) -> None: ...
def close(self) -> None: ...
# metadata functions
def tables(self) -> Cursor: ...
def columns(self) -> Cursor: ...
def statistics(self) -> Cursor: ...
def rowIdColumns(self) -> Cursor: ...
def rowVerColumns(self) -> Cursor: ...
def primaryKeys(self) -> Cursor: ...
def foreignKeys(self) -> Cursor: ...
def getTypeInfo(self) -> Cursor: ...
def procedures(self) -> Cursor: ...
def procedureColumns(self) -> Cursor: ...
# a Row object represents a single database record, and behaves somewhat similar to a NamedTuple
class Row:
cursor_description: Tuple[Tuple[str, Any, int, int, int, int, bool]]
# implemented dunder methods
def __contains__(self, key, /) -> int: ...
def __delattr__(self, name, /) -> None: ...
def __delitem__(self, key, /) -> None: ...
def __eq__(self, value, /) -> bool: ...
def __ge__(self, value, /) -> bool: ...
def __getattribute__(self, name, /) -> Any: ...
def __getitem__(self, key, /) -> Any: ...
def __gt__(self, value, /) -> bool: ...
def __le__(self, value, /) -> bool: ...
def __len__(self, /) -> int: ...
def __lt__(self, value, /) -> bool: ...
def __ne__(self, value, /) -> bool: ...
def __reduce__(self) -> Any: ...
def __repr__(self, /) -> str: ...
def __setattr__(self, name, value, /) -> None: ...
def __setitem__(self, key, value, /) -> None: ...
# module functions
def dataSources() -> Dict[str, str]: ...
def drivers() -> List[str]: ...
def setDecimalSeparator(sep: str, /) -> None: ...
def getDecimalSeparator() -> str: ...
# https://www.python.org/dev/peps/pep-0249/#connect
def connect(connstring: Optional[str] = None,
/, *, # only positional parameters before, only named parameters after
autocommit: bool = False,
encoding: str = 'utf-16le',
ansi: bool = False,
readonly: bool = False,
timeout: int = 0,
attrs_before: dict = {},
**kwargs) -> Connection: ...
